Hurriyat M demands release of detainees

Hurriyat Conference (M) on Thursday demanded immediate and unconditional release of all those arrested and lodged in various jails in and outside J&K.

In a statement, the party said it expresses concern over the condition of Kashmiri prisoners including Hurriyat leaders and activists, youths and Kashmiri from all walks of life who were detained in Tihar Jail, KotB halwal Jail, Jodhpur Jail, Agra Jail, Amphala Jail, Haryana Jail and various other jails and those who have been put under house arrest, before and after August 5 last year. The party said its Chairman, Mirwaiz Moulvi Muhammad Umar Farooq, who is also leading religious leader of J&K, continues to be under house arrest since 5 August 2019.
